Treatment Approaches                                                                                     
Wendy Gray specializes working with adults, adolescents, and children (3 and older) who have difficulties with depression, anxiety, self-harm, trauma, sexual abuse, rape, parenting, child and adolescent behavior problems, ADHD in children and adults, severe medical issues, and grief. Wendy believes that when people are given a safe place to process life experiences and given unconditional acceptance, they can learn about themselves and reevaluate their thoughts and behaviors.
 
Wendy utilizes Cognitive Behavioral Therapy techniques that provides psychoeducation, learning new coping skills which include meditation and stress relief techniques, and challenging one’s thinking and language patterns. She also uses Adlerian techniques such as the use of genograms, sand tray play therapy, family constellation, and personal priorities. Wendy also provides Play Therapy for children 3 years -12 years. Christian counseling is offered upon request.
 
Education and Training
Wendy received her Bachelor of Arts degree in Psychology from North Carolina State. She is currently attending Amberton University where she will graduate in March of 2022 with a degree in Licensed Professional Counseling  (LPC). Wendy is also a member of the Texas Counseling Association as well as the American Counseling Association. Wendy attended the American Play Therapy conference in 2019 where she attended workshops on Sensory Processing Disorder and Neurodiversity Through Play Therapy. She also attended the workshop on Using Play Therapy with Abused and Traumatized Children. Further training includes Trauma-Related Disorders and the Covid-19 Pandemic as well as Ethical Problem Solving: Working with Youth and their Families both from The Cognitive Behavior Institute.
 
Background and Experience
Wendy has professional experience working with teens with adjustment and drug and alcohol issues at Kidspeace Treatment Center in Pennsylvania. She has also spent her career with children in early education as a teacher trained in Conscious Discipline and as a Director in Christian Preschools. Wendy has volunteered at Wisdom’s Hope as a parent educator in Parenting with Boundaries.
